Step 1: Get the Official Symbol Reference (Don't Guess)

The first mistake I see? People rely on memory or the sticker itself. Get the Caterpillar Operator's Manual (free on cat.com). Every model—from a Cat 797F mining truck to a 303 excavator—has a dedicated section on warning symbols. If I remember correctly, the 797F manual has over 40 unique symbols for hydraulic, electrical, and rollover hazards. Print the page. Laminate it. Put it in the cab.

Common symbol categories you'll find:

  • Red: Immediate hazard (fire, explosion, electric shock)
  • Orange: Moving parts, pinch points, hot surfaces
  • Yellow: Caution—read the manual before operation
  • Green: Safety information (emergency stop, first aid)

Step 2: Audit Your Current Fleet for Missing or Faded Symbols

I assumed all our machines came with intact decals (assumption failure). Didn't verify. Turned out three of our twelve excavators were missing the high-pressure fluid warning decal—worn off by heat and dirt. That's a $4,200 redo waiting to happen when a technician doesn't realize 4,000 PSI of hydraulic fluid can inject through skin. Walk each machine with the symbol reference. Mark missing decals and order replacements from Cat dealer parts. Cost of a decal: $8–12. Cost of a safety incident: insurance nightmare.

Step 4: Check Electrical Components—GFCI Breakers Are Not Optional

Speaking of hidden costs: GFCI breakers. On mobile equipment with auxiliary power (like a Cat 797F's AC inverter or a generator set), GFCI protection is critical. Most buyers ask 'what's the best price?' The better question is 'does this unit include GFCI on all 120V outlets?' Because adding one after a fault costs you the service call ($250–400) plus the breaker itself ($40–80) plus downtime. We had a GFCI breaker trip on a site trailer that knocked out communications for 4 hours—lost productivity, lost time.

Per OSHA 1926.404(b)(1)(ii), GFCI protection is required for 120V, 15- and 20-amp receptacles on construction sites. But I've seen rental fleets skip it. Add GFCI check to your inspection checklist. (Note to self: also verify NEMA enclosure ratings—a breaker exposed to dust fails faster.)

Step 5: Evaluate Attachments—That 'Paddle Attachment' May Cost You More

When you see 'paddle attachment' in a Cat accessory catalog, it's usually a material-handling tool (like a paddle broom for sweeping or a paddle mixing attachment for slurry). The mistake? Buying a third-party attachment because it's $200 cheaper, then discovering the hydraulic coupling doesn't match. Stick to Cat attachments or verified compatibles. I almost went with a budget paddle broom once—the local dealer quoted $950, an online vendor $780. Looked like a no-brainer until I calculated TCO: the $780 option didn't include Cat-specific quick-coupler brackets (extra $180), had a 3-week lead instead of 3 days ($400 lost in rental costs waiting). Total: $780 + 180 + 400 = $1,360. Dealer's $950 includes everything, no waiting. That's a 43% difference hidden in fine print.

Common Mistakes to Avoid

  • Ignoring the 'read manual' symbol. I've seen operators start a machine without checking the CDI (critical design information). That's how a $50 hose burst becomes a $6,000 engine fire. (Ugh.)
  • Assuming OEM vs. aftermarket decals are the same. Aftermarket decals can fade in UV faster (we had a set turn illegible within 8 months). OEM lasts 3–5 years. Cost difference: $10 per decal. Worth it.
  • Not documenting symbol training in the procurement contract. When you lease a Cat 797F, ask the dealer: 'Do you provide a symbol walkthrough for my operators?' If no, budget $500 for an hour of training. Amazing how often this is overlooked.
